Mendeleev’s periodic table is, more accepted for its originality and boldness in making corrections in the properties and predicting unknown elements.
- Mendeleev was the first one to establish a systematic arrangement and bring out the periodicity of properties of elements with atomic weight and propose a periodic law.
- It could point out the incorrect atomic weight of some elements known at that time.
- It could predict the existence of other elements and could predict their properties so, as to leave space in the periodic table.
- It could accommodate all the sixty elements discovered at that time and could accommodate the noble gases which, where discovered later.
